Quite possible culprit is thermal transfer to the heatsink too. I've seen occurrences of thermal patches badly (or not at all) applied on the die. Five of the 8 PC laptops I owned suffered from that, and a cleanup + proper thermal paste cured it on three. The two others simply had bad design and just could not get the heat out for some reason.
